[packages/arm-trusted-firmware] build and package fiptool; rel 2
atler
atler at pld-linux.org
Sun Nov 7 00:29:57 CET 2021
commit 41820156b4d39ca4f1b4aa3f61f9ca672d6a37df
Author: Jan Palus <atler at pld-linux.org>
Date: Sun Nov 7 00:18:45 2021 +0100
build and package fiptool; rel 2
arm-trusted-firmware.spec | 12 ++++++++++--
1 file changed, 10 insertions(+), 2 deletions(-)
---
diff --git a/arm-trusted-firmware.spec b/arm-trusted-firmware.spec
index cde67e9..1d809d8 100644
--- a/arm-trusted-firmware.spec
+++ b/arm-trusted-firmware.spec
@@ -1,7 +1,7 @@
Summary: ARM Trusted Firmware
Name: arm-trusted-firmware
Version: 2.5
-Release: 1
+Release: 2
License: BSD
Group: Base/Kernel
Source0: https://git.trustedfirmware.org/TF-A/trusted-firmware-a.git/snapshot/trusted-firmware-a-%{version}.tar.gz
@@ -52,10 +52,15 @@ for soc in rk3399; do
PLAT="$soc" \
bl31
done
+%{__make} -C tools/fiptool \
+ V=1 \
+ HOSTCC="%{__cc}" \
+ HOSTCCFLAGS="%{rpmcflags}" \
+ CPPFLAGS="%{rpmcppflags}"
%install
rm -rf $RPM_BUILD_ROOT
-install -d $RPM_BUILD_ROOT%{_datadir}/%{name}
+install -d $RPM_BUILD_ROOT{%{_bindir},%{_datadir}/%{name}}
for soc in rk3399; do
install -d $RPM_BUILD_ROOT%{_datadir}/%{name}/$soc
@@ -66,10 +71,13 @@ install -d $RPM_BUILD_ROOT%{_datadir}/%{name}/$soc
done
done
+cp -p tools/fiptool/fiptool $RPM_BUILD_ROOT%{_bindir}
+
%clean
rm -rf $RPM_BUILD_ROOT
%files -n arm-trusted-firmware-armv8
%defattr(644,root,root,755)
%doc readme.rst
+%attr(755,root,root) %{_bindir}/fiptool
%{_datadir}/%{name}
================================================================
---- gitweb:
http://git.pld-linux.org/gitweb.cgi/packages/arm-trusted-firmware.git/commitdiff/41820156b4d39ca4f1b4aa3f61f9ca672d6a37df
More information about the pld-cvs-commit
mailing list